Transaction 5cdfd0563490a9210f28ab7077f85dc8edc757e85aee7f21bf3eabcd236bd6f1
1 Input
1 Outputs
- 5cdfd0563490a9210f28ab7077f85dc8edc757e85aee7f21bf3eabcd236bd6f1:0
value 571284
address 31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z